Spain’s workforce is characterized by a combination of traditional industrial employment, a growing services sector, and a rapidly evolving digital economy, which together shape demand for time and attendance software. The labor market includes permanent full-time employees, part-time staff, temporary and seasonal workers, and freelancers, particularly in sectors such as tourism, retail, logistics, manufacturing, healthcare, IT, and professional services. Multi-site operations, regional offices, and distributed teams pose challenges in managing attendance, shift rotations, overtime, and absenteeism. Traditional methods, including manual timesheets and punch cards, are increasingly seen as inefficient and prone to errors, prompting organizations to adopt digital attendance platforms. Hybrid and flexible work arrangements are becoming common, especially in IT, professional services, and education, requiring mobile-enabled and cloud-based solutions that allow employees to record hours remotely while maintaining managerial oversight. Seasonal labor demands in tourism, retail, and logistics amplify the need for scalable systems capable of handling temporary surges without disrupting payroll or operational efficiency.

Employers leverage these platforms not only to track attendance accurately but also to optimize scheduling, improve labor allocation, and monitor productivity. Advanced features such as biometric verification, mobile clock-ins, and integration with HR and payroll systems ensure data accuracy, operational transparency, and compliance readiness, particularly in multi-site or high-labor-intensity environments. The Spanish Workers’ Statute (Estatuto de los Trabajadores) establishes limits on weekly and daily working hours, mandatory breaks, night shifts, and overtime compensation, while collective bargaining agreements in sectors such as manufacturing, healthcare, public administration, and transportation add further obligations. Failure to comply can result in inspections, fines, or disputes with labor unions, making reliable digital attendance systems essential. Additionally, Spain’s implementation of the General Data Protection Regulation (GDPR) mandates strict handling of employee attendance data, requiring secure storage, controlled access, and audit trails to ensure compliance and protect privacy.

Time and attendance systems are therefore valued not only for operational efficiency but also as governance tools that mitigate legal risk, support internal audits, and ensure consistent adherence to labor laws. Features such as automated alerts for overtime breaches, compliance reporting, and error validation help organizations monitor workforce activity while maintaining transparency. In Spain, attendance software serves as both an operational and compliance solution, enabling employers to accurately record hours worked, track leave and absences, calculate overtime, and maintain alignment with labor regulations and privacy requirements. Organizations require platforms that can accommodate complex workforce arrangements, including rotating shifts, flexible work hours, part-time employees, and temporary or freelance staff, while minimizing administrative errors. Advanced features like biometric authentication, mobile clock-ins, geolocation tracking, and automated compliance alerts are increasingly prevalent to ensure accuracy, reliability, and regulatory adherence.

Services complement the software by supporting implementation, integration, customization, training, and ongoing maintenance. Implementation services configure attendance rules, labor law compliance, and internal HR policies within the system, while integration services ensure seamless data exchange with payroll and enterprise platforms. Customization services enable companies to adapt reporting formats, workflow notifications, and alert mechanisms to operational and sector-specific requirements. Training services ensure employees and managers use the system consistently, particularly in multi-site operations, industrial facilities, and distributed teams. Maintenance and support services provide updates, compliance adjustments, and troubleshooting, reducing reliance on internal IT resources. Managed services are gaining traction among SMEs and multi-location enterprises seeking uninterrupted operational efficiency and compliance assurance.

BFSI institutions use these platforms to track employee hours, manage overtime, and ensure payroll accuracy across offices and branch networks while complying with labor laws. Retail and e-commerce organizations implement attendance systems to manage hourly employees, seasonal labor peaks, and multi-location scheduling efficiently, reducing operational errors and labor costs. The IT and telecommunications sector relies on attendance software to support hybrid work models, project-based time tracking, and remote workforce management while maintaining productivity visibility. Government and public sector entities deploy these solutions to standardize attendance processes, enforce policy compliance, and maintain transparency across ministries, agencies, and municipal offices. Healthcare and life sciences organizations use attendance platforms to manage complex shift rotations, on-call scheduling, and compliance with labor regulations, which directly impact service quality and operational efficiency.

Manufacturing companies adopt these systems to coordinate multi-shift operations, optimize labor utilization, and monitor overtime, particularly in unionized or regulated environments. Educational institutions rely on attendance software to track faculty, administrative staff, and support personnel, especially in universities or schools with multiple campuses. Other industries, including logistics, hospitality, and professional services, implement attendance systems to improve workforce visibility, operational efficiency, and schedule adherence. These organizations need scalable systems that can manage large employee populations, multi-shift operations, union agreements, and flexible work arrangements, while providing centralized reporting, audit readiness, and operational visibility. Integration with HR, payroll, and enterprise systems is critical for efficiency, data accuracy, and adherence to labor regulations, particularly in sectors such as manufacturing, logistics, healthcare, and finance.

Large enterprises prioritize reliability, customization, and compliance monitoring to meet both operational and legal obligations. Small and medium enterprises (SMEs) are increasingly adopting digital attendance solutions to reduce administrative burden, improve payroll accuracy, and enhance operational control. Cloud-based offerings allow SMEs to access advanced features without large upfront investment, including mobile access, real-time reporting, and integration with payroll and HR systems. SMEs prioritize ease of deployment, intuitive user interfaces, minimal training requirements, and compliance features to manage distributed or remote teams efficiently. Biometric and mobile solutions are particularly relevant for SMEs with field-based or flexible workforces. Cloud-based solutions are increasingly preferred for their flexibility, scalability, and ability to provide centralized oversight across multiple locations and remote employees. Cloud deployment enables real-time monitoring, automated updates, seamless integration with HR and payroll systems, and simplified compliance management, reducing reliance on internal IT teams. These solutions are particularly attractive for SMEs and organizations managing hybrid or geographically dispersed workforces, offering operational efficiency and regulatory compliance with minimal infrastructure investment. On-premises deployment remains relevant for large enterprises, government bodies, and unionized sectors that require direct control over sensitive employee data, customized workflows, and integration with legacy systems. On-premises systems allow organizations to maintain audit readiness, enforce complex labor rules, and ensure data security and governance compliance. Deployment decisions are shaped by workforce complexity, sector-specific labor regulations, operational strategy, and IT planning.

While cloud solutions are favored for scalability, accessibility, and rapid deployment, on-premises solutions remain critical where control, customization, and security are prioritized.
